Evaluation of EtherCAT Clock Synchronization in Distributed Control Systems

2014 
* Dept. of Mechanical and Information Engineering, Univ.of Seoul. (Received April 9, 2014 ; Revised May 20, 2014 ; Accepted May 20, 2014)Key Words: EtherCAT(이더캣), Clock Synchronization(시계 동기화), Performance Evaluation(성능 평가), Real-time Ethernet(실시간 이더넷), Distributed System(분산 시스템).초록: EtherCAT의 시계 동기화 기법인 DC(Distributed Clock)는 실시간 분산 제어 시스템에서 고도로 동기화된 기능의 설계를 가능하게 한다. 본 논문은 실제 자동화 시스템에서의 광범위한 실험을 통해 EtherCAT DC 기법의 성능을 평가한다. Xenomai와 IgH EtherCAT 스택을 이용하여 EtherCAT 제어 시스템을 구축하고, 네트워크 내의 노드 간 시계 편차를 분석한다. 실험 결과, 동기 시계의 정확도는 슬레이브 장치의 개수, 드리프트 보정의 주기, 시스템 기준 시계의 종류 등 많은 요소에 의해 영향을 받음을 알 수 있었다. 특히, 시스템 기준 시계의 종류에 따라 마스터 장치의 동작이 근본적으로 상이하며 매우 다른 성능 특성을 초래하므로, 기준 시계의 선택은 신중히 이루어져야 함을 알 수 있었다.Abstract: Support for the precise time synchronization of EtherCAT, known as distributed clock (DC), enables the design of highly synchronized operations in distributed real-time systems. This study evaluates the performance of the EtherCAT DC through extensive experiments in a real automation system. We constructed an EtherCAT control system using Xenomai and IgH EtherCAT stack, and analyzed the clock deviation for different devices in the network. The results of the evaluation revealed that the accuracy of the synchronized clock is affected by several factors such as the number of slave devices, period of drift compensation, and type of system time base. In particular, we found that careful decision regarding the system time base is required because it has a fundamental effect on the master operation, which results in significantly different performance characteristics.
    • Correction
    • Source
    • Cite
    • Save
    • Machine Reading By IdeaReader
    18
    References
    0
    Citations
    NaN
    KQI
    []